Verdict: DeepSeek-V4-Flash-Max vs GPT-5.2 — which is better?

DeepSeek-V4-Flash-Max (by DeepSeek) and GPT-5.2 (by OpenAI) are two of the AI models people compare most. Here is how they stack up on benchmarks, price and capabilities, and which one to pick in 2026.

DeepSeek-V4-Flash-Max outperforms in 4 benchmarks (BrowseComp, Humanity's Last Exam, MCP Atlas, Toolathlon), while GPT-5.2 is better at 2 benchmarks (GPQA, SWE-Bench Verified). DeepSeek-V4-Flash-Max shows notably better performance in the majority of benchmarks.

On price, DeepSeek-V4-Flash-Max is roughly 38.5x cheaper per token on a blended 3:1 input/output basis, which adds up quickly at production volume.

DeepSeek-V4-Flash-Max also accepts a larger context window (1,048,576 input tokens), making it the stronger choice for long documents and large codebases.

Pricing Analysis

Price comparison per million tokens

DeepSeek-V4-Flash-Max costs less

For input processing, DeepSeek-V4-Flash-Max ($0.10/1M tokens) is 17.5x cheaper than GPT-5.2 ($1.75/1M tokens).

For output processing, DeepSeek-V4-Flash-Max ($0.20/1M tokens) is 70.0x cheaper than GPT-5.2 ($14.00/1M tokens).

In conclusion, GPT-5.2 is more expensive than DeepSeek-V4-Flash-Max.*

* Using a 3:1 ratio of input to output tokens

Context Window

Maximum input and output token capacity

DeepSeek-V4-Flash-Max accepts 1,048,576 input tokens compared to GPT-5.2's 400,000 tokens. GPT-5.2 can generate longer responses up to 128,000 tokens, while DeepSeek-V4-Flash-Max is limited to 65,536 tokens.

License

Usage and distribution terms

DeepSeek-V4-Flash-Max is licensed under MIT, while GPT-5.2 uses a proprietary license.

License differences may affect how you can use these models in commercial or open-source projects.
